Landon's Story

 

Landon Rogers
Age 6

Whenever gift shop employees feel a little tug at their pant leg, they knows it’s one of their favorite patients—Landon Rogers—looking for a bright-colored gumball. One employee says “her heart smiles” whenever 6-year-old Landon visits. The hearts of employees throughout Providence Health & Services Alaska react the same way when they encounter the sweet little boy from Kenai, Alaska, whose life has been spent almost entirely within the hospital.

Landon’s life has been one of medical trial after medical trial. A premature birth was the first of a host of medical conditions that compounded each year. From a life-threatening respiratory virus at 3-months old, to failure to thrive, to eye and lung cancer, Landon has endured like a true champion. In 2007 he was diagnosed with hemophagocytic lymphohistiocytosis, or HLH, a rare genetic disorder that compromises his immune system.

Despite his medical challenges, Landon has lived with gusto. Wherever he is you’ll find laughter and no matter where he goes, hearts certainly smile.
